Output 85ff64afb8b57796b7a85dc669a19af23bed7f1d244e89f13d87e52b483d2ebf:1

value
5417900
script pubkey
OP_0 OP_PUSHBYTES_20 071f2e3294c8934b33303bcbde1d065a2743039e
address
bc1qqu0juv55ezf5kves809au8gxtgn5xqu7dd00t2
transaction
85ff64afb8b57796b7a85dc669a19af23bed7f1d244e89f13d87e52b483d2ebf
spent
true